DescriptionNVD

IBM Db2 11.5.0 through 11.5.9, and 12.1.0 through 12.1.5 is vulnerable to privilege escalation with a specially crafted query.

AnalysisAI

Privilege escalation in IBM Db2 (data server versions 11.5.0-11.5.9 and 12.1.0-12.1.5) allows an attacker to submit a specially crafted query that bypasses authorization controls and gains elevated database privileges, classified as CWE-285 improper authorization. IBM reported the issue and has published a fix; there is no public exploit identified at time of analysis and it is not on CISA KEV. …

Exploit Scenario An attacker with the ability to reach the Db2 query interface - for example a low-privileged database user or a network client able to authenticate - submits a specially crafted query that triggers the improper authorization check, granting them elevated privileges and full read/write control over database contents. Because SSVC marks the technique as automatable, the query could be embedded in a script and run against many instances; no public exploit code is identified at time of analysis.
